025 - Your Car Put You in Timeout


Listen Later

This week on Logging In, Techie and Kali kick things off with the viral rise of Danhausen and why storytelling may be making a comeback in entertainment. From miniature cloning-machine chaos in wrestling to social media stardom, they explore how one performer is capturing attention far beyond his industry.

Then the conversation shifts into the growing role of AI in everyday life. What happens when your car decides you're too tired, emotional, or distracted to drive? Could future vehicles literally put you in timeout? The hosts debate privacy, safety, and the risks of letting algorithms make decisions that used to belong to people.

Also in this episode: China's attempt to slow AI-driven job replacement, the surprising crowdfunded effort to buy Spirit Airlines, YouTubers discovering that free speech works differently around the world, and why the FBI is warning some people to replace aging wireless routers.

From wrestling clones to smart cars, airlines, AI, and digital surveillance, Episode 25 explores a common question: Who should be making the decisions—people, governments, corporations, or algorithms?
